    Our Mosholu Day Camp will return to our

    new antastic country site at Harriman State Park

    on beautiul Lake Cohasset.

    Our exclusive site has wonderul acilities.

    The crib dock system on the lake allows us to

    teach all children how to swim no matter their

    level. We also teach ishing, canoeing, kayaking

    and row-boating on our large beautiul lake.

    We have many buildings on the site.Each group has their own bunk cabins. A large

    recreation building oers dance, Native American

    culture and learning. Our Stone Community

    House oers music and dancing. Campers eat

    lunch (which they bring) in the large open air

    pavilion. There is also a nature center.

    A large sports ield is used or baseball,

    soccer, hockey and ield games. A itness course,

    biking, playground and archery are also available.

    CIT PRoGRAM | CouNsELoRs IN TRAININGProessional development opportunity or summer 2013.

    Applicants must be 15 or 16 years old no later thanJune 1, 2013 and have an interest in working in our day

    camp. Proo o age and working papers are required. All whoapply or a CIT position must plan to participate in six work-

    shop sessions. There is a $35 registration ee. Those selectedas a CIT will be assigned to the day camp and will receive a

    $300 stipend or the summer, including all staf orientations.Applicatin can be bmitted at the MMCC main dek.
